Файлы индекса базы данных — документация GitHub Enterprise Server 38 – полное руководство

Github

Файлы индекса в базе данных GitHub Enterprise Server 38 являются важной частью системы, обеспечивающей эффективное хранение, поиск и доступ к информации. Индексные файлы содержат метаданные о хранящихся в базе данных объектах, таких как репозитории, коммиты, ветки и теги, и позволяют быстро находить и получать доступ к нужным данным.

Они создаются и поддерживаются автоматически системой, в процессе добавления, изменения или удаления объектов в базе данных. Файлы индекса содержат информацию о структуре базы данных и ее состоянии, а также используются для оптимизации процессов поиска и обновления данных.

В процессе работы базы данных, GitHub Enterprise Server 38 создает и обновляет различные типы файлов индекса, в том числе индексы поиска, индексы сортировки и индексы ссылок между объектами. Это обеспечивает эффективность и быстродействие системы, позволяет снизить нагрузку на сервер и улучшить пользовательский опыт.

Первый раздел

Файлы индекса базы данных представляют собой основу системы управления базами данных. Они содержат информацию о структуре и содержимом базы данных. Файлы индекса играют важную роль в обеспечении быстрого доступа к данным и оптимизации выполнения запросов.

Индексы являются структурами данных, которые позволяют быстро находить нужные записи в базе данных. Они содержат информацию о расположении и содержимом записей, а также организованы таким образом, чтобы обеспечить эффективный доступ к данным. Каждый индекс может быть создан на одной или нескольких колонках таблицы и позволяет быстро выполнить операции поиска, сортировки и слияния данных.

В файле индекса базы данных содержится информация о структуре индекса, о колонках таблицы, на которых созданы индексы, а также о расположении данных внутри индекса. Файл индекса имеет специальную структуру, которая позволяет эффективно хранить и обрабатывать данные.

Файлы индекса могут быть организованы по-разному, но обычно они состоят из блоков, которые содержат информацию о ключах и значении индекса. Каждый блок содержит ссылки на другие блоки, что позволяет обеспечить эффективный поиск данных.

Различные базы данных могут использовать разные алгоритмы и структуры для хранения и обработки файлов индекса. Некоторые базы данных могут использовать B-деревья, B+деревья, хэш-таблицы или другие структуры данных.

Важно понимать, что файлы индекса являются критически важной частью базы данных и их правильная организация и обслуживание могут существенно повлиять на производительность системы.

Первый подраздел раздела

В данном подразделе представлена информация о файлах индекса базы данных. Файлы индекса используются для оптимизации и ускорения поиска данных в базе. Они содержат структурированные указатели на записи, что позволяет быстро находить нужные данные.

Читать:  Документация GitHub Enterprise Server 36 Фиксации: понятные инструкции и руководства

Файлы индекса обычно состоят из блоков, каждый из которых содержит определенное количество записей. Каждая запись содержит ключ и ссылку на соответствующую ей запись в файле данных. Индексы могут быть уникальными или неуникальными. В случае уникального индекса каждый ключ в индексе должен быть уникальным.

Когда производится поиск данных по ключу, система проверяет файл индекса и находит нужную запись. Затем она использует ссылку из индекса для получения данных из файла данных. Благодаря использованию файлов индекса, поиск данных может быть выполнен значительно быстрее, чем при простом последовательном чтении всей базы данных.

Название файла Описание
index1.dat Файл индекса для таблицы “Товары”
index2.dat Файл индекса для таблицы “Заказы”
index3.dat Файл индекса для таблицы “Клиенты”

В файле индекса можно найти информацию о структуре ключей и ссылках на соответствующие им записи в файлах данных. Также в файле индекса могут быть представлены дополнительные данные, необходимые для оптимизации процесса поиска. Например, в некоторых случаях индексы могут содержать информацию о диапазонах ключей, что позволяет сократить количество проверок при поиске данных.

Описание файлов

Документация GitHub Enterprise Server 38 содержит следующие файлы индекса базы данных:

Название файла Описание
index.html Главная страница документации, содержащая общую информацию о GitHub Enterprise Server 38.
install.html Страница с инструкцией по установке GitHub Enterprise Server 38.
usage.html Страница с инструкцией по использованию GitHub Enterprise Server 38.
configuration.html Страница с описанием конфигурации GitHub Enterprise Server 38.

Второй подраздел раздела

Во втором подразделе раздела о файлах индекса базы данных рассматриваются основные принципы работы с этими файлами.

Файлы индекса базы данных являются частью структуры хранения данных в базе данных.

Индексы предоставляют быстрый доступ к данным и позволяют эффективно выполнять запросы.

Они создаются для одного или нескольких полей таблицы и содержат информацию о расположении записей в базе данных.

Оптимальное использование файлов индекса может существенно повысить производительность работы базы данных.

В данном подразделе рассматриваются основные аспекты использования файлов индекса: создание, обновление, удаление и оптимизация индексов.

Также будет описано, какие типы индексов существуют и как выбрать подходящий для каждой конкретной задачи.

Наконец, будет рассмотрен процесс планирования индексов для базы данных и оптимальные стратегии использования индексов.

Обновление файлов

При работе с GitHub Enterprise Server 38 вы можете обновлять файлы в базе данных. Это может быть полезно, если вы хотите внести изменения в существующие данные или добавить новые файлы.

Существует несколько способов обновления файлов:

Способ Описание
Через веб-интерфейс Вы можете войти в свою учетную запись на GitHub Enterprise Server 38, перейти в нужный репозиторий, выбрать файл, который вы хотите обновить, и нажать на кнопку “Редактировать”. Затем вы можете внести необходимые изменения и сохранить файл.
С помощью Git Вы можете склонировать репозиторий на свой локальный компьютер, внести необходимые изменения в файлы и зафиксировать изменения с использованием команд Git, таких как git add, git commit и git push.
С использованием API Если вы являетесь разработчиком, вы можете использовать GitHub API для обновления файлов в базе данных. API предоставляет различные методы для работы с файлами, такие как создание файла, обновление файла и удаление файла.
Читать:  Настройка OpenID Connect в HashiCorp Vault - руководство GitHub Enterprise Cloud Docs

Независимо от выбранного способа, обновление файлов должно быть осуществлено аккуратно, чтобы избежать потери данных или нарушения работоспособности системы. Рекомендуется перед обновлением файлов создать резервную копию базы данных, чтобы иметь возможность восстановить данные в случае необходимости.

Второй раздел

В данном разделе мы рассмотрим основные подходы к созданию файлов индекса баз данных и их особенности.

1. Планирование структуры файлов индекса:

Перед тем как приступить к созданию файлов индекса, необходимо провести тщательное планирование структуры данных, которую они будут содержать. Важно учесть размеры таблиц и количества записей, чтобы выбрать наиболее оптимальный подход к разделению и организации файлов индекса.

2. Выбор типа файлов индекса:

Наиболее распространенными типами файлов индекса являются B-деревья, хеш-таблицы и инвертированные индексы. Каждый тип имеет свои достоинства и ограничения, поэтому выбор зависит от особенностей конкретной базы данных.

3. Размещение файлов индекса:

Оптимальное распределение файлов индекса по физическим носителям позволяет достичь более высокой производительности системы. Это может быть реализовано путем размещения файлов на разных дисках или создания специального RAID-массива.

4. Обновление файлов индексов:

При изменении данных в базе данных необходимо обновлять соответствующие индексы. Для достижения оптимальной производительности рекомендуется использовать специальные алгоритмы обновления, которые минимизируют количество операций.

5. Оптимизация запросов:

При создании файлов индекса важно учитывать типы запросов, которые будут выполняться. Нередко требуется оптимизация запросов путем создания соответствующих индексов или изменения структуры существующих.

Следуя данным рекомендациям, вы сможете создать эффективные файлы индекса базы данных и повысить производительность системы в целом.

Первый подраздел раздела

В данном разделе мы рассмотрим первый подраздел. Этот подраздел представляет собой важный компонент файла индекса базы данных и отвечает за информацию об объектах в базе данных.

Первый подраздел содержит следующую информацию:

  • Имя объекта: указывает на имя объекта в базе данных.
  • Тип объекта: указывает на тип объекта, например, таблица, представление, индекс и т. д.
  • Размер объекта: указывает на размер объекта в байтах.
  • Дата создания: указывает на дату и время создания объекта.
  • Дата изменения: указывает на дату и время последнего изменения объекта.

Первый подраздел позволяет быстро находить и анализировать информацию об объектах базы данных. Используя эту информацию, вы можете легко найти объекты, узнать их размер и дату создания/изменения, что крайне полезно при администрировании базы данных.

В следующем подразделе мы рассмотрим второй подраздел. Он содержит информацию о связях между объектами в базе данных.

Добавление файлов

В GitHub Enterprise Server существует несколько способов добавления файлов в репозиторий. Рассмотрим каждый из них подробнее.

1. Веб-интерфейс

Вы можете загрузить файлы прямо через веб-интерфейс GitHub. Для этого перейдите в нужный репозиторий, затем в раздел “Code” и нажмите на кнопку “Add file”. В появившемся выпадающем меню выберите, какой способ загрузки файлов вам удобен: загрузка одного файла, загрузка нескольких файлов или создание файла прямо в браузере. После выбора, перетащите или выберите файлы на вашем компьютере и нажмите кнопку “Commit”. Новые файлы будут добавлены в репозиторий.

Читать:  Синхронизация вилки — документация GitHub Enterprise Server 37

2. Git

Git – это распределенная система контроля версий, которая также может использоваться для добавления файлов в репозиторий GitHub. Для этого вам потребуются некоторые знания командной строки Git. В первую очередь, вам нужно склонировать репозиторий на локальный компьютер с помощью команды git clone. Затем создайте новый файл в нужной директории, добавьте его в индекс с помощью команды git add и зафиксируйте изменения командой git commit. Наконец, отправьте изменения в удаленный репозиторий с помощью команды git push. Ваши файлы будут добавлены в репозиторий на GitHub.

3. GitHub Desktop

Если вам неудобно использовать командную строку Git, вы можете воспользоваться альтернативным клиентом GitHub Desktop. Он предоставляет графический интерфейс для работы с репозиториями на GitHub. Чтобы добавить файлы в репозиторий, откройте репозиторий в GitHub Desktop, нажмите на кнопку “Add” и выберите нужные файлы на вашем компьютере. Затем нажмите на кнопку “Commit” и “Push origin” для отправки изменений на GitHub.

Таким образом, вы можете легко добавлять новые файлы в репозиторий GitHub Enterprise Server, выбрав подходящий для вас способ: через веб-интерфейс, командную строку Git или GitHub Desktop.

Вопрос-ответ:

Какие данные хранятся в файлах индекса базы данных?

Файлы индекса базы данных содержат информацию о структуре и расположении данных в базе данных. Они включают в себя информацию о таблицах, столбцах, индексах и связях между таблицами.

Какие операции можно выполнять с файлами индекса базы данных?

С помощью файлов индекса базы данных можно выполнять операции чтения и записи данных. Они позволяют получать информацию о структуре базы данных и использовать ее для запросов и манипуляций с данными.

Какие преимущества предоставляет использование файлов индекса базы данных?

Использование файлов индекса базы данных обеспечивает быстрый доступ к данным, ускоряет выполнение запросов и операций с базой данных. Они также позволяют оптимизировать структуру данных и улучшить производительность системы.

Что произойдет, если файл индекса базы данных будет поврежден или удален?

Повреждение или удаление файла индекса базы данных может привести к неработоспособности базы данных или потере данных. В таком случае будет необходимо восстановить базу данных из резервной копии или провести восстановление индексов.

Можно ли изменять файлы индекса базы данных вручную?

Манипуляции с файлами индекса базы данных вручную не рекомендуются, так как это может вызвать нарушение целостности данных и привести к ошибкам в работе базы данных. Лучше использовать специализированные инструменты и команды для управления индексами.

Какие файлы индекса базы данных использует GitHub Enterprise Server?

GitHub Enterprise Server использует несколько файлов индекса базы данных, включая `index`, `rev`, `pack` и `bitmap` файлы.

Какие преимущества использования файлов индекса базы данных в GitHub Enterprise Server?

Использование файлов индекса базы данных в GitHub Enterprise Server позволяет обеспечить более эффективное хранение и доступ к данным, ускоряет операции чтения и записи, а также повышает общую производительность системы.

Видео:

2.9 Git – Основы – Удаление и переименование файлов

2.9 Git – Основы – Удаление и переименование файлов by JavaScript.ru 43,816 views 2 years ago 8 minutes, 18 seconds

Оцените статью
Программирование на Python